I'd say the book of Revelation would be the classic example in Western culture. The sounding of the trumpet, the seven seals being unsealed, the four horsemen, natural disasters, fantastical monsters, the rise of an antichrist, and so on. Similarly, the tearing of the Temple curtain, as happened at Jesus' death.
